summaryrefslogtreecommitdiffstats
path: root/include/linux/fsl_devices.h
diff options
context:
space:
mode:
authorSuresh Gupta2019-06-24 09:22:16 +0200
committerGreg Kroah-Hartman2019-07-03 18:52:20 +0200
commit5dfff995f9cb21c2910e40f5d4da53473356a792 (patch)
tree92c692395379b592d35230299c103a375d211284 /include/linux/fsl_devices.h
parentusb: fsl: Set USB_EN bit to select ULPI phy (diff)
downloadkernel-qcow2-linux-5dfff995f9cb21c2910e40f5d4da53473356a792.tar.gz
kernel-qcow2-linux-5dfff995f9cb21c2910e40f5d4da53473356a792.tar.xz
kernel-qcow2-linux-5dfff995f9cb21c2910e40f5d4da53473356a792.zip
usb: phy: Workaround for USB erratum-A005728
PHY_CLK_VALID bit for UTMI PHY in USBDR does not set even if PHY is providing valid clock. Workaround for this involves resetting of PHY and check PHY_CLK_VALID bit multiple times. If PHY_CLK_VALID bit is still not set even after 5 retries, it would be safe to deaclare that PHY clock is not available. This erratum is applicable for USBDR less then ver 2.4. Signed-off-by: Suresh Gupta <B42813@freescale.com> Signed-off-by: Yinbo Zhu <yinbo.zhu@nxp.com> Link: https://lore.kernel.org/r/20190624072219.15258-2-yinbo.zhu@nxp.com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
Diffstat (limited to 'include/linux/fsl_devices.h')
0 files changed, 0 insertions, 0 deletions